As parents, there’s nothing scarier than the thought of losing our child. But did you know suicide is the leading cause of death for youth ages 10-24 in the United States?  One of the biggest fears parents have is missing the warning signs.  And the question we all want answered is: how can I tell if my teen is at risk?

In today’s episode we’re diving deep into Spotting Teen Suicide Risk with Dr. Jessica Rabon, a licensed clinical psychologist specializing in pediatric psychology.  She’ll help us break down the common warning signs, dispel some myths, and give us the tools we need to have that crucial conversation with our teens.  Whether you’re worried about a specific behavior or just want to be proactive, this episode is for you.
